Discussion on the relation between diorite-porphyrite dike and tungsten mineralization of Sanjiazi tungsten deposit in Siping of Jilin

WANG Hui-1, REN Yun-Sheng-1, NIU Jun-Ping-2, JU Nan-1

1�� College of Earth Sciences��Jilin University��Changchun 130061��China; 2�� Geophysical Exploration Institute of Jilin Province��Changchun 130012��China

Abstract��

Sanjiazi deposit is a skarn scheelite mineral deposit newly found in Northeast China�� The dikes developed well in mining area��in which the diorite-porphyrite dike controlled the outcrop of tungsten ore body in space with close relation to tungsten mineralization��which is one of the important indicators for tungsten prospecting in this area�� The diorite-porphyrite generated prior to scheelite mineralization�� Compared with the trace elements and REE of the dike��granite body and scheelite ore��the conclusion can be drawn that the diorite-porphyrite has similarity with granite body and scheelite ore in main trace elements contents and comparability in REE contents�� and belongs to homologous relationship in origin��
